Analysis

The most recent figure for change in poverty gap due to out-of-pocket health spending ($ 2011) in United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land is 0, measured in 2013. That is the lowest value across all 5 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 100.0% on the previous year and down 100.0% over five years.

Over the whole period, change in poverty gap due to out-of-pocket health spending ($ 2011) in United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land peaked at 0.0001 in 2010 and was at its lowest, 0, in 1995.

That places United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land 42nd out of 46 countries with data for 2013, putting it in the bottom quarter.
